The size of Dawesville is approximately 18.6 square kilometres. There are 25 parks, covering nearly 15.2% of the total area. The population of Dawesville in 2016 was 5824 people. By 2021 the population was 7143 showing a population growth of 22.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dawesville is 60-69 years. Households in Dawesville are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dawesville work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 83.30% of the homes in Dawesville were owner-occupied compared with 77.90% in 2016.
